Output d9df672366f3bc85bcaa51e2319ae91efca2213f0b54e2dc47d209155c7aff6b:0

value
105631
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5425870d582b46c0b5be56576ea785b9651e9853 OP_EQUAL
address
39Mwe7kZ9jjvHDv5UFHGQr8Cm5oR1aevb3
transaction
d9df672366f3bc85bcaa51e2319ae91efca2213f0b54e2dc47d209155c7aff6b
confirmations
54098
spent
true